Please join us in Charlotte for the Third Southeastern Health Planning Symposium. This Symposium is a forum for planners, regulators, lawyers, and judges to share ideas and perspectives about health planning and Certificate of Need laws and developments.  Speakers from North Carolina, South Carolina, Georgia, Florida and Tennessee will discuss CON, licensure and other health planning developments in their respective states. A welcome reception will also be held Thursday evening, starting at 6:00 p.m.
